MarketSummary

-Omahamulti-familyvacancyis8.3%,whichis110basispointshigherthanlastquarterand270basispointshigherthanoneyearago.

-Averageaskingrentsarenow$1,288perunitinthemetroarea,fallingforthefirsttimesince

thefirstquarterof2010.Averageaskingrentsare$5.00,or0.4%,lowerthanlastquarter,butare$53.00,or4.3%higherthanoneyearago,and$134,or11.6%higherthanthreeyearsago.Bysubmarket,thehighestaveragerentis$1,582perunitintheSouthwestsubmarket.Byage,

propertiesbuiltbetween2000and2025representthehighestrentwithanaveragerentof

$1,478perunit.Averageaskingrentis$1,300perunitinthedowntownareaversus$1,287perunitinsuburbanareas.

-TheOmahamulti-familymarketdeliveredtwopropertiestotaling657unitstothemarketduringthefourthquarterof2025,bringingyear-to-datedeliveriesto3,793units.

-Thereareanadditional21propertiestotaling2,720unitsunderconstructionintheOmaha

market.Bysubmarket,thegreatestnumberofunitsintheconstructionpipelinearelocatedintheCentral,DowntownandSouthwestsubmarketswith27.7%,17.5%and16.9%ofthetotal

numberofunits,respectively.

EconomicSummary

National

TheU.S.economyissendingsomemixedsignals.Financialmarketsarefocusedontheupside,particularlyAI’ssizablecontributiontogrowthinrecentquarters.Someindicatorsofbusinessactivity,suchascapitalgoodsorders,areimproving,andstrengtheningcreditmarketsare

helpingtousherrealestateintoanewcycle.Thepicturegetsmoremelancholywhenlookingathouseholds.Consumerconfidenceremainsweak,withspendingreportedlydrivenbyasmallersegmentofaffluenthouseholds.ThismosaicofdatasuggeststhatannualaverageGDPgrowthwillbesteadyin2026,at2%,butatouchsofterthanin2025.Akeycatalystisasofterlabor

market,ascompaniesare‘slowtohire,slowtofire’—atrendthatislikelytolastafewquarters.Aconsequenceofthisoutlookissofterinflationandlong-termbondyieldstrendingjustbelow4%byH22026.

Local

TheU.S.CensusBureauannouncedearlierthisyearthattheOmahametropolitanareanowhasapopulationofover1million.Thereareseveralprojectsunderwayandannouncedto

accommodatethispopulationgrowthandcarryOmahaintothefuture.

AccordingtotheOmahaWorldHerald,aspokespersonforEppleyAirfieldestimatedarecord

numberoftravelers,275,000,topassthroughtheairportduringthe18-daywinterholidaytravelperiod.Thisrepresentsaprojected4.6%increaseintravelersoverthesameperiodin2024.A$1billionterminalmodernizationprojectiscurrentlyunderway,whichwillnearlydoublethesizeoftheexistingterminalatEppleyAirfield.Thisprojectisexpectedtobecompletedin2028and

willbetteraccommodatetheincreaseintraveltoandfromOmaha.Additionally,thisexpansionhastheexpectedresultofaddingyear-roundnon-stopinternationaldestinationstothe

CaribbeanandMexicoasdemandgrows.

A$421millionstreetcarprojectisunderwayandexpectedtobecompletedin2028.The

streetcarwillconnecttheBlackstonedistrict,beginningatSouth40thStreet,toDowntown,endingatSouth8thStreet,alongFarnamStreet.Infrastructurework,includingworkongasutilitylines,water,sewerandpowerlinesishappeningthrough2027,withmainlinetrack

Local(cont.)

constructionexpectedtobeginin2026andcontinuethrough2028.

Constructionofthestreetcarwillbenefitbusinessesalongtherouteinthelongrun.However,intheshort-termthesebusinessesareexperiencinglowfoottrafficandlaggingsalesduetotheconstructionhappeningoutsidetheirdoors.InanefforttoencourageconsumerstovisittheseretailersintheinterimthecitylaunchedaFutureRidersPassportProgram,offeringvisitorsa

chancetowinprizes.Cityleadersassurebusinessesthatutilityandroadworkiscomplete,theprojectisexpectedtohavelessimpactonthepublic.Constructionoftheactualstreetcarlinewillbemorelinearandlessdisruptivetopedestriansandmotoriststhantheutilityprojects.
